I was able to download the PowerBIEmbedded_AppOwnsData MVC code update the parametes, run it locally and everything worked successfully everytime. However, now I published the solution to our test IIS server and I get the following error:
System.ArgumentNullException: Value cannot be null.
Parameter name: authority
at Microsoft.IdentityModel.Clients.ActiveDirectory.Authenticator.DetectAuthorityType(String authority)
at Microsoft.IdentityModel.Clients.ActiveDirectory.Authenticator..ctor(String authority, Boolean validateAuthority)
at PowerBIEmbedded_AppOwnsData.Controllers.HomeController.<EmbedReport>d__9.MoveNext() in C:\Users\[myusername]\Documents\PowerBI-Developer-Samples-master\PowerBI-Developer-Samples-master\App Owns Data\PowerBIEmbedded_AppOwnsData\Controllers\HomeController.cs:line 48
Any ideas would be greatly appreciated. I also don't see how it has embedded my original file directory.
Solved! Go to Solution.
I was able to solve this problem. All I had to do was move the cloud.config file over to my site and restart the site (or wait a while) and it was working as expected
Under the pbiPassword key, within the app settings in Web.config, I had to add this:
<add key="authorityUrl" value="https://login.windows.net/common/oauth2/authorize/" />
<add key="resourceUrl" value="https://analysis.windows.net/powerbi/api" />
<add key="apiUrl" value="https://api.powerbi.com/" />
<add key="embedUrlBase" value="https://app.powerbi.com/" />
Got that from https://community.powerbi.com/t5/Developer/App-owns-data-Sample-Azure-Problem/td-p/425097
